Re: [SlimDevices: Plugins] ANNOUNCE: YouTube Plugin (API v3)

2018-10-14 Thread fredbloggs


I imagine this is already in this post somewhere but it is quite long.

I have followed the instructions on the plugin page (v0.70) and have got
as far as authorising the code (took about 15 minutes before a code
would appear), however am unsure what to enter in the 'YouTube API
access key' at the top.

I have used the same code as the client id, but when I do a search I get
no return and if I search 'my subscriptions' then I get an error 'Oauth
configuration missing, please see YouTube plugin settings'

If I look at the credentials for my API I can see the settings created
listed under oAuth 2.0 credentials.

Where amI going wrong?  (suspect the youtube API access key settings)
